    No one is addressing registration. That is the first step where those unauthorized to vote get registered. If a person who is unauthorized to vote is registered to vote, voter ID isn't going to stop that. Those felons who weren't authorized to vote were still on the registration roles to vote. An voter ID wouldn't have stopped them from voting. They were on the registration rolls and as far as most knew, still authorized to vote.

    If their names had been removed from the rolls, they couldn't have voted. Voter ID may stop those few who try to pass themselves off as someone else, such as was done to by neighbor when she tried to vote in the afternoon only to find out someone had voted in her place. I doubt that happens much.

    Trying to catch unauthorized voters at the polling place in my opinion is like trying to catch the horses after they left the barn.
